Land Administration Manager jobs in California

Land Administration Manager manages the proper receiving, recording, documentation, and dissemination of all land agreements and land contracts. Serves as a liaison to the land department and customers to ensure proper interpretation of land agreements and contracts. Being a Land Administration Manager requires a bachelor's degree. Typically reports to a head of a unit/department. The Land Administration Manager manages subordinate staff in the day-to-day performance of their jobs. True first level manager. Ensures that project/department milestones/goals are met and adhering to approved budgets. Has full authority for personnel actions. Extensive knowledge of department processes. To be a Land Administration Manager typically requires 5 years experience in the related area as an individual contributor. 1 to 3 years supervisory experience may be required.     The Maintenance Manager is responsible for managing all plant equipment, inclusive of utilities, is maintained and operated in a safe and efficient manner. Coordinates and oversees all plant engineering functions and projects inclusive of design, implementation, commissioning and control. The Maintenance Manager will recognize the need for improvements and effectively manages implementation of change. Fosters collaboration and teamwork. Gains support and commitment from within plant departments, as well as with other divisions within the organization. Supports Land O'Lakes values and integrity in all plant activities. Promotes an environment for open and timely communication and actively enlists input from others and responds to others respectfully.


    Hours: This role is typically 1st shift hours, but requires occasional off shift hours, weekends, and holidays.

    Compensation Range: $88,800 – $133,000

    Job Duties:
    • Ensure that the WWTP is operated in a safe and efficient manner and that all relevant regulatory requirements are satisfied. Liaison with the various state and federal regulatory agencies and maintain good relations.
    • Implement and control a sludge management program inclusive of dewatering, storage, sampling, disposal and record keeping.
    • Direct the service, repair and rebuilding of all mechanical, pneumatic and electronic equipment plant wide. Maintain upkeep on buildings and grounds. Oversee and direct the preventative maintenance program.
    • Maintain support services at a constant state of readiness and make recommendations as may be necessary to ensure adequate back up.
    • Make recommendations for modification, repair and new equipment installations as may be needed to maintain and improve operations. Oversee and direct the completion of these assignments.
    • Maintain an energy tracking program to ensure optimal energy utilization, increased operational efficiencies and reduced costs.
    • Maintain close liaison with all other departments ensuring open communication and the timely and accurate transfer of relevant information as may be necessary.
    • Review daily, weekly and monthly maintenance schedule, assign tasks to be performed to team.
    • Develop and execute training plan for maintenance workers.
    • Ensure that Maintenance jobs are in accordance with all corporate policies and legislated regulations.

    • Maintain adequate spares to ensure smooth plant operations.

California is a state in the Pacific Region of the United States. With 39.6 million residents, California is the most populous U.S. state and the third-largest by area. The state capital is Sacramento. The Greater Los Angeles Area and the San Francisco Bay Area are the nation's second and fifth most populous urban regions, with 18.7 million and 9.7 million residents respectively. Los Angeles is California's most populous city, and the country's second most populous, after New York City.
